# -*- mode: org -*- #+TITLE: Rstudio #+AUTHOR: Arnaud Legrand #+DATE: June, 2018 #+STARTUP: overview indent #+OPTIONS: num:nil toc:t * Installing Rstudio ** Linux (debian, ubuntu) We provide here only instructions for debian-based distributions. Feel free to contribute to this document to provide up-to-date information for other distributions (e.g.n redhat, fedora). Today, the stable versions of the most common distributions provide recent enough versions of emacs and org-mode: - Debian (stretch) ships with [[https://packages.debian.org/stretch/r-base][R 3.3.3-1]], [[https://packages.debian.org/stretch/r-cran-knitr][knitr 1.15.1]], and [[https://packages.debian.org/stretch/r-cran-ggplot2][ggplot 2.2.1]] - Ubuntu (bionic 18.04) ships with [[https://packages.ubuntu.com/bionic/r-base][R 3.4.4]], and [[https://packages.ubuntu.com/bionic/r-cran-knitr][knitr 1.17]], and [[https://packages.ubuntu.com/bionic/r-cran-ggplot2][ggplot 2.2.1]] - Ubuntu (artful 17.04) ships with [[https://packages.ubuntu.com/artful/r-base][R 3.4.2]], and [[https://packages.ubuntu.com/artful/r-cran-knitr][knitr 1.15]], and [[https://packages.ubuntu.com/artful/r-cran-ggplot2][ggplot 2.2.1]] If your distribution is older than this, well, it may be a good time for upgrading... *** Installing R Beforehand, you need to install the R language and convenient packages by running (as root): #+BEGIN_SRC shell apt-get update ; sudo apt-get install r-base r-cran-knitr r-cran-ggplot2 #+END_SRC Alternatively, if the installation of =r-cran-gplot2= or =r-cran-knitr= fails, you may want to install them locally (through the R packaging system) and manually by running the following commands in R (or Rstudio): #+BEGIN_SRC R install.packages("knitr") install.packages("ggplot2") #+END_SRC If you plan to export pdf documents with LaTeX, you probably also want to run (as root): #+begin_src sh :results output :exports both apt-get update ; apt-get install texlive-base #+end_src *** Installing rstudio Rstudio is unfortunately not packaged within debian so the easiest is to download the corresponding debian package on the [[https://www.rstudio.com/products/rstudio/download/#download][Rstudio webpage]] and then to install it manually (depending on when you do this, you can obviously change the version number). Here is how to install it: #+BEGIN_SRC shell cd /tmp/ wget https://download1.rstudio.org/rstudio-xenial-1.1.453-amd64.deb sudo dpkg -i rstudio-xenial-1.1.453-amd64.deb sudo apt-get update ; sudo apt-get -f install # to fix possibly missing dependencies #+END_SRC ** Mac OSX and Windows #+BEGIN_QUOTE Some instructions on installing R and knitr must be missing. This should be tested and improved. #+END_QUOTE Download and install rstudio from the [[https://www.rstudio.com/products/rstudio/download/#download][Rstudio webpage]] by choosing the right operating system. Then open Rstudio and type the following commands in the console to install knitr and ggplot2: #+BEGIN_SRC R install.packages("knitr") install.packages("ggplot2") #+END_SRC * Installing Git ** Linux (debian, ubuntu) We provide here only instructions for debian-based distributions.
